About

Le Lapin Sauté centers its culinary focus on regional French preparations featuring rabbit as a signature element. The menu emphasizes locally sourced ingredients transformed through classic market cooking techniques. Diners encounter dishes like rabbit confit and braised cuts that showcase depth of flavor and traditional preparation methods. The architectural space utilizes exposed stone walls and wooden beams to define the interior atmosphere. Tables occupy a rustic environment that reflects a historical regional building style. The selection of poultry and game selections provides a cohesive narrative centered on seasonal offerings and farm to table sensibilities. Every plate maintains a strict adherence to authentic regional standards by highlighting the versatility of game meat in modern kitchen applications.

Review Summary

Le Lapin Sauté is widely celebrated as a charming, cozy, and quintessential destination in Old Quebec City, particularly favored for its authentic rabbit and duck specialties. Many visitors praise the restaurant for its warm, welcoming staff, impeccable service, and a picturesque patio perfect for people watching in the Petit Champlain district. While the majority of diners highlight the high quality of dishes like the rabbit poutine, cassoulet, and salted honey pie, some guests have noted inconsistencies in food preparation, occasional service delays, or a preference for larger portion sizes. Despite the high demand making reservations essential, most guests consider it a must-visit venue that captures a unique, intimate atmosphere suitable for families and romantic outings alike.
